0%

The role involves preparing and delivering lectures, developing course materials, assessing student performance, conducting research, and contributing to the academic environment of the institution.

The Job

  • Prepare and deliver lectures, tutorials, workshops in various IT subjects.
  • Utilize a variety of teaching methods and instructional technologies to enhance the learning experience.
  • Ensure that course content is current, relevant, and aligned with industry standards and advancements.
  • Design and administer assessments, exams, projects, and assignments.
  • Provide timely and constructive feedback to students on their performance.
  • Engage in scholarly activities, research, and publication in the field of Information Technology.
  • Stay current with developments in the IT field and integrate new knowledge into teaching practices.
  • Mentor students in their academic and career pursuits, including guiding them on research projects and professional development.
  • Establish and maintain partnerships with industry professionals and organizations.

The Person

  • Degree with a specialization in information technology, computer science, software engineering, or computer networking with a second class or first class degree from a recognized university.
  • Having an MSc in Information Technology, Data Analytics, Cyber Security or related discipline
  • Candidates with a PhD in IT or PhD reading are encouraged to apply
  • Prior experience in teaching at the undergraduate level is preferred
  • Industry experience in IT or related fields is an advantage.
  • Strong knowledge of IT principles, practices, and technologies.
  • Excellent teaching, presentation, and communication skills.
Apply

Email your CV to careers@esoft.lk or fill the form below




    Upload Your Resume




    Other Available Opportunities